Start a revolution instead.James Watt started a rebellion against tasteless mass market beers by founding BrewDog, now one of the worlds best-known and fastest growing craft breweries, famous for beers, bars, and crowdfunding. In this smart, funny book, he shares his story and explains how you too can tear up the rule book and start a company on your own terms. Its an anarchic, DIY guide to entrepreneurship-and a new manifesto for business.After spending seven years on the high seas of the North Atlantic, James Watt started BrewDog craft brewery in Scotland with his best friend, Martin Dickie. They didnt have a business plan. All they had was a mission to revolutionize beer drinking and make other people as passionate about craft beer as they are.Theyve succeeded. Within a few years, BrewDog was huge-a world-famous craft brewery with beer bars around the globe and hundreds of thousands of fans. Those fans became literal backers of their business with the introduction of an unprecedented crowdfunding movement, Equity for Punks. And in rewriting the record books and kickstarting a revolution-James and BrewDog inadvertently forged a whole new approach to business.Business for Punks bottles the essence of Jamess methods in an accessible, honest manifesto. Among his mantras: Cash is motherf*cking king. Cash is the lifeblood of your company. Monitor every penny as if your life depends on it-because it does. Get people to hate you. You wont win by trying to make everyone happy, so dont bother. Let haters fuel your fire while you focus on your hard-core fans. Steal and bastardize from other fields. Take inspiration freely wherever you find it- except from people in your own industry. Job interviews suck. They never reveal if someone will be a good employee, only how good that person is at interviews. Instead, take them for a test drive and see if theyre passionate and a good culture fit.Business for Punks rethinks conventional business wisdom so you can go beyond the norm. Its an anarchic, indispensable guide to thriving on your own terms.

Paperback. Condition: Very Good. BrewDog's co-founder James Watt offers a business bible for a new generation. It's anarchic. It's irreverent. It's passionate. It's BrewDog. Don't waste your time on bullshit business plans. Forget sales. Ignore advice. Put everything on the line for what you believe in. These mantras have turned BrewDog into one of the world's fastest-growing drinks brands, famous for beers, bars and crowdfunding. Founded by a pair of young Scots with a passion for great beer, BrewDog has catalysed the craft beer revolution, rewritten the record books and inadvertently forged a whole new approach to business. In BUSINESS FOR PUNKS, BrewDog co-founder James Watt bottles the essence of this success. From finances ('chase down every cent, pimp every pound') to marketing ('lead with the crusade, not the product') this is an anarchic, indispensable guide to thriving on your own terms.
